Colorado Takes a Step Towards a More Sustainable Future: Electric Vehicle Battery Recycling Bill Signed into Law In a significant move towards reducing waste and promoting environmental sustainability, Colorado Governor Jared Polis has signed a bill into law that aims to establish a comprehensive framework for the recycling of electric vehicle (EV) batteries in the state. The new legislation requires manufacturers to take responsibility for the recycling of their EV batteries at the end of their life cycle, marking a significant shift towards a more circular economy. As the demand for EVs continues to rise, the recycling of their batteries becomes increasingly important to minimize the environmental impact of the growing industry. With this new law, Colorado is setting a precedent for other states to follow, highlighting the importance of responsible waste management in the transition to a low-carbon economy.
